What is Artificial Intelligence?
What is Artificial Intelligence? Artificial Intelligence, commonly abbreviated as AI, describes the simulation of human knowledge processes by equipments, particularly computer systems. These processes include finding out, reasoning, and self-correction.
AI has a remarkable background, dating back to the mid-20th century when the initial AI programs were created. Throughout the years, AI has progressed substantially, bring about various sorts of AI systems, such as slim AI, basic AI, and superintelligent AI.
Key components of AI include formulas, data, and computational power.
A part of AI, known as machine learning, focuses on developing formulas that enable computer systems to gain from and make forecasts or decisions based upon data. Within machine learning, deep understanding attracts attention as a details kind that uses semantic networks to mimic the means the human mind jobs.
Machine learning and deep learning have reinvented different sectors, from healthcare to finance, by enhancing automation, anticipating analytics, and customization."

In Finance
In the money industry, AI is pivotal in fraud detection, risk management, and algorithmic trading, allowing more safe and secure and efficient economic procedures.
In regards to AI applications in economic services, the use cases are diverse and impactful. For example, in credit rating, AI models such as random woodlands and gradient enhancing algorithms are typically employed to assess information and evaluate credit reliability more precisely and rapidly. These versions can process huge quantities of information points and deal histories to predict the likelihood of default.
Client service chatbots driven by natural language processing (NLP) methods like recurrent neural networks (RNNs) are revolutionizing customer communications. They give instantaneous actions to inquiries, automate regular jobs, and individualize client experiences.

Programming Languages
Effectiveness in programs languages such as Python, R, and Java is important for AI-related jobs, as these languages are commonly utilized in creating AI algorithms and applications.
In the realm of artificial intelligence, Python attracts attention as one of one of the most prominent and versatile languages, understood for its readability and convenience of use. R, on the other hand, is commonly utilized for analytical evaluation and data visualization, making it vital for AI projects involving information handling. Java, with its effectiveness and system self-reliance, prevails in constructing enterprise-level AI services.
Understanding these languages is promoted by a wide range of resources and devices readily available online, from interactive coding systems like Codecademy and LeetCode to extensive programs on systems like Coursera and Udemy. Accepting these sources can help people master these languages and improve their effectiveness in establishing AI options.

Machine Learning and Deep Learning
Artificial Intelligence and Deep Learning Machine learning and deep knowing are critical parts of AI, making it possible for systems to learn from data and boost their performance gradually without explicit shows.
Machine learning involves the procedure of teaching a computer system to identify patterns and make decisions based on data. Supervised knowing is a typical method where the model is trained on classified information. On the other hand, unsupervised knowing take care of finding concealed patterns or inherent frameworks in unlabeled data.
Neural networks are foundational in deep learning, simulating the human brain's interconnected neurons. They consist of layers of nodes that refine info through complex mathematical transformations. Popular structures like TensorFlow and PyTorch provide tools for structure and training neural networks successfully.

Ethical Concerns
Ethical problems in AI revolve around concerns such as predisposition, justness, openness, and accountability, which can substantially influence the trustworthiness and social acceptance of AI technologies.
One major honest issue in AI is mathematical predisposition, where AI systems might inadvertently discriminate against specific teams based upon prejudiced data or flawed formulas. This can bring about unreasonable outcomes in various industries such as hiring, borrowing, and healthcare.
Lack of openness further aggravates these worries, as it becomes hard to recognize how decisions are made by AI systems. The challenge of responsibility develops when AI makes essential decisions without clear lines of duty.
To deal with these difficulties, numerous efforts and structures have actually been presented to advertise honest AI growth. For example, organizations like the Partnership on AI and the IEEE have actually established guidelines and principles to make sure that AI innovations are developed and made use of in a accountable and moral fashion.
The growth of AI values boards within business and regulative bodies aids in evaluating the moral ramifications of AI applications and fostering liability. By thinking about these moral problems and applying ideal structures, we can work in the direction of building AI systems that are reasonable, transparent, and liable to all stakeholders.
